Cases:

Making a rugged customized carrying case /
accessory case from one of the cheap aluminum
cases available from the larger stores is cost
effective and easy. Polyethylene foam is often
used as it doesn't retain gases, doesn't hold
moisture, and its compression properties will hold
your valuables very well.

Construction:

Today we see more and more new homes and
buildings that are being insulated and decorated
with shapes cut from foam. Hundreds of
different architectural shapes like moldings,
trims, bands, cornices, sills, balusters and
columns are easily cut to supply this large
industry.

Packaging:

Foam is one of the best and least expensive
packaging materials used to protect products.

Packaging customers often need large numbers
of the same shape.

Sound Proofing:

Egg crate foam is recommended if you want the
good sound deadening qualities of wedge foam,
but at a budget-conscious price. Eggcrate /
convoluted foam's style keeps its price low, yet
allows it to absorb sound very well for the price.

Egg crate foam is also a good choice for people
who want to cover their sound deadening foam
